I was trying to drain the lower unit on my 5HP GoodYear Sea Bee and cannot get the vent screw to budge. Any tips on loosening this old screw?

Ouch, that's a tough one. Ordinarilly I'd say to use an impact screwdriver, but that screw is so small you will probably just twist it off. That might wind up being the result anyway and you will have to drill it out.

I was able to get it loose by getting a large screwdriver and putting vice clamps on the handle and pressing down while rotating the vice clamps.
